DQ250 DSG 02E Transmission Mechatronics Control Unit 02E927770AT

The DQ250 DSG 02E Transmission Mechatronics Control Unit 02E927770AT is a precision-engineered component designed for Audi vehicles (models w, A3, V). This valve body ensures seamless hydraulic fluid control in dual-clutch transmissions (DSG), enabling smooth gear shifts and optimal performance under high-pressure conditions.
